Output 3e23a0839d2f75bbccf564fd2b88ae7cb990c77c27b7d2ec10e81f0cb17dba6f:0

value
25086847
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a3cc5e39161fbd42b21b37bb1589242df9f71e OP_EQUALVERIFY OP_CHECKSIG
address
1DYmoBrFyziQfqvu6uThyYRipNYpbaooDx
transaction
3e23a0839d2f75bbccf564fd2b88ae7cb990c77c27b7d2ec10e81f0cb17dba6f
confirmations
476830
spent
true